Valores QueryString removidos do terminal IPN pelo PayPal [fechado]

Tivemos uma integração de pagamento simples com o PayPal por 5 anos, que foi executada sem problemas até hoje. No URL do IPN (notify_url) passamos 3 valores na string de consulta, por exemplo

https://www.example.com/callback/ipn?pspId=A&secCode=MnBP%2fxOwbQhXLd%2arD5xd6g%3d%3d&isPur=false

Hoje, o PayPal retira os dois últimos valores e liga apenas com o primeiro valor da string de consulta, por exemplo,

https://www.example.com/callback/ipn?pspId=A

Nós usamos osecCode valor como uma assinatura que verificamos no retorno de chamada para impedir qualquer modificação no formulário. Por que o PayPal de repente começou a retirar valores da string de consulta? Eu suspeito que eles deveriam estar no POST, mas não sei por que a mudança repentina?

questionAnswers(1)

yourAnswerToTheQuestion